Deep Space
Deep Space is Good Folks Coffee's love letter to the dark roast drinker—the person who wants smoke, boldness, and that unmistakable depth that only a well-executed dark roast can deliver. Roasted in Portland, this blend is built from coffees specifically selected to thrive under extended heat, transforming into something rich, assertive, and deeply satisfying. This isn't a roast that's trying to hide inferior beans; it's a deliberate expression of what dark roasting can achieve when done with intention. Tasting Notes Expect a full-bodied cup dominated by dark chocolate and subtle smokiness, with low acidity that makes it incredibly approachable whether you're drinking it black or cutting it with cream and sugar. The finish is long and warming, with lingering notes of toasted grain and cocoa.
